Comprehending Conservatories
A conservatory is defined as a room with glass walls and a glass roofing system, designed to enable maximum sunlight entry while producing a space that links with outdoor landscapes. While they came from as areas to grow plants, today's conservatories are used for multifunctional functions.

The products picked for a conservatory are important not simply for visual purposes, but also for structural stability and energy effectiveness. The most typical products include:
uPVC: Lightweight and low maintenance, uPVC is typically the most affordable option. It is energy-efficient and offered in numerous colors.Aluminium: Known for its toughness and slim profiles, aluminium enables bigger glass panes, increasing natural light. It is more pricey than uPVC however needs little maintenance.Wood: A standard option that offers natural beauty. Wood provides excellent insulation, however it requires more upkeep gradually.Glass: High-performance glass alternatives, including double or triple glazing with thermal breaks, are vital to boost energy effectiveness and decrease heat loss.Planning Your Conservatory

Do I need preparing approval for a conservatory?
Oftentimes, conservatories do not need planning authorization if they meet specific conditions, such as size and height restrictions. Nevertheless, it is necessary to contact your local planning authority.
2. For how long does it take to build a conservatory?
The timeline for developing a conservatory can vary based on size and intricacy however normally ranges from a couple of weeks to a number of months, consisting of planning and construction.
3. Can I utilize my conservatory year-round?
Yes, with correct insulation, heating, and ventilation systems, a conservatory can be utilized year-round. Think about energy-efficient glazing and heating alternatives to keep comfort.
4. How do I preserve my conservatory?
Upkeep can generally be very little, however routine cleaning of the glass, inspecting for leaks, and making sure the frames remain in good condition is advantageous.
